Jingchao Liu is a scholar working on Materials Chemistry, Renewable Energy, Sustainability and the Environment and Electrical and Electronic Engineering. According to data from OpenAlex, Jingchao Liu has authored 28 papers receiving a total of 702 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Materials Chemistry, 12 papers in Renewable Energy, Sustainability and the Environment and 9 papers in Electrical and Electronic Engineering. Recurrent topics in Jingchao Liu’s work include Advanced Photocatalysis Techniques (12 papers), Copper-based nanomaterials and applications (7 papers) and Gas Sensing Nanomaterials and Sensors (5 papers). Jingchao Liu is often cited by papers focused on Advanced Photocatalysis Techniques (12 papers), Copper-based nanomaterials and applications (7 papers) and Gas Sensing Nanomaterials and Sensors (5 papers). Jingchao Liu collaborates with scholars based in China, Saudi Arabia and United States. Jingchao Liu's co-authors include Mingfei Shao, Jianming Li, Ruikang Zhang, Simin Xu, Jian Guo, Min Wei, Shouli Bai, Aifan Chen, Yanfei Li and Ruixian Luo and has published in prestigious journals such as The Science of The Total Environment, Chemical Communications and Applied Catalysis B Environment and Energy.
